		Hungarian director 
		
		István 
		Szabó 
		
		received 
		a FIPRESCI 100 lifetime achievement award 
		
		On May 16th, Hungarian director István Szabó received a FIPRESCI 100 
		lifetime achievement award before the world premiere of the restored 
		copy of his film “Sunshine”. Szabó, who won the FIPRESCI Cannes prize in 
		1980 for his “Mephisto”, received the award from the festival general 
		delegate Thierry Fremaux and FIPRESCI president Ahmed Shawky.

			THE GOLD RUSH: 100TH YEAR ANNIVERSARY! 
 
			
			After La Maman et la putain, L’Amour fou and Napoléon par Abel 
			Gance, the Festival de Cannes will premiere as a worldwide 
			pre-opening film on Tuesday, May 13, 2025, at 3PM in Debussy 
			Theater, Charlie Chaplin’s The Gold Rush. 
			
			The Gold Rush by 
			Charlie Chaplin (1925, 1h28, United States) 
			
			 (La Ruée vers l’or) 
			
			Screening in the presence of Arnold Lozano, Director of Roy Export 
			SAS. |

			Waqai sinin al-djamr by 
			Mohamed Lakhdar Hamina (1975, 2h51, Algeria) 
			
			(Chronique des années de braise / Chronicle of the Years of Embers) 
 
			
			A presentation by the Lakhdar Hamina family, distribution in French 
			theaters: Les Acacias. A restoration by The Film Foundation’s World 
			Cinema Project and Cineteca di Bologna at L’Image Retrouvée (Paris) 
			and L’Immagine Ritrovata (Bologna) laboratories. The restoration was 
			funded by the Hobson/Lucas Family Foundation and is part of the 
			African Film Heritage Project, an initiative created by The Film 
			Foundation’s World Cinema Project, the Pan African Federation of 
			Filmmakers (FEPACI) and UNESCO – in collaboration with Cineteca di 
			Bologna – to help locate, restore, and disseminate African cinema. 
			
			Screening in attendance of Tarek Lakhdar Hamina, Malik Lakhdar 
			Hamina and Merwan Lakhdar Hamina, actors of the film and sons of 
			director Mohamed Lakhdar Hamina. |

											Saïd Effendi by 
											Kameran Hosni (1955, 1h31, Iraq) 
			
			(Saeed Effendi) 
 
			
			Presented by the Al-Hasan Ibn Al-Haytham Committee for Iraqi Visual 
			Memory and the Iraqi Cinematheque Project. 
			
			Restored in 4K by the Institut National de l’Audiovisuel (INA) from 
			the original 35mm negative image and 35mm optical sound print. 
			Restoration completed in 2025 as part of the Iraqi Cinematheque 
			Project, supported by the French Ministry for Europe and Foreign 
			Affairs and implemented by Expertise France. 
			
			Screening in the presence of Dr. Hassan Al-Sudani, Chairman of 
			Al-Hasan Ibn Al-Haytham Committee for Iraqi Visual Memory, and 
			Wareth Kwaish, Project Manager of the Iraqi Cinematheque Project for 
			Expertise France. |

				Cinéma de la Plage 2025 
				
				
				Official Selection 
				
				Every day at 9:30PM, the Festival de Cannes reinvents itself as 
				night falls, transforming the Croisette’s Plage Macé, opposite 
				the Majestic hotel, into an open-air cinema. In addition to the 
				screenings, meetings and Official Selection events held at the 
				Palais des Festivals, this is another way for everyone to get 
				involved to the great cinema party. 
				
				The program for the 78th Festival will include: film teams on 
				stage, premieres and world cinema classics. From Hong Kong 
				action to Italian intimism, from Japanese animation to Hollywood 
				classics, embark on a cinephile’s world tour that concludes 
				with Any Number Can Win… on the sands of Cannes! 
				
				This now traditional rendezvous is open to festival-goers and 
				all audiences, with a choice “warm-up” act every evening: the 
				duo TwinSelecter. Rock, pop, soul, funk, punk, mambo, electro, 
				film soundtracks, jazz, disco, psychedelic, hiphop, garage, to 
				get you going before the screening! |

			BARRY LYNDON CLOSES CANNES CLASSICS 
			
			Stanley Kubrick’s masterpiece in a brand-new 4K restoration to close 
			the section on Friday May 23 in the Debussy Theater. 
			
			Barry Lyndon by 
			Stanley Kubrick (1974, 3h04, United Kingdom/ United States) 
			
			A Warner Bros. and Park Circus Presentation. Barry Lyndon is 
			presented in the film’s photographed aspect ratio of 1.66:1, as 
			specified in a December 8, 1975, letter from director Stanley 
			Kubrick to projectionists. This new 4K restoration was sourced from 
			a 4K scan of the 35mm original camera negative. The high-definition 
			transfer, created in 2000 under the supervision of Leon Vitali 
			(Kubrick’s personal assistant), served as a color reference for this 
			restoration.  The 5.1 surround audio mix was created from restored 
			original soundtrack stems. Color Grading: Sheri Eisenberg at Warner 
			Bros. Motion Picture Imaging. Digital image restoration: Prasad 
			Corporation, Burbank. 
			
			Audio restoration: Chris Jenkins at WB. Post Production Services 
			Sound 
			
			This 4K digital restoration of Barry Lyndon was undertaken by the 
			Criterion Collection in 2025, from a scan of the 35 mm original 
			camera negative. The sound was sourced from the original 35mm 
			magnetic tracks. |

											Award for Best Immersive Work of the 
											78th Festival de Cannes The Jury of the Immersive 
											Competition of the 78th Festival de 
											Cannes presented today the Best 
											Immersive Work Award to From 
											Dust, 
											created by Michel van der Aa, 
											recognizing a creation that pushed 
											the boundaries of storytelling, art 
											space, and audience engagement.
